• My NEW theme keeps reverting to default. I have no plugins that would cause this.

    I tried to overwrite the default with my NEW theme- but the default theme still shows.

    So how do I COMPLETELY replace the default with my NEW theme- so when I choose the NEW theme- and it reverts to default- default will be the NEW theme also

Viewing 8 replies - 1 through 8 (of 8 total)
  • rename the “default” theme folder to something else
    make a copy of your new theme folder and name it “default”
